Changing the Cisco Discovery Protocol Settings Some network devices do not use Cisco Discovery Protocol (CDP). To change whether the phone transmits CDP packets and settings associated with CDP, follow these steps: Procedure Step 1 Step 2 Step 3 Step 4 Step 5 Step 6 Step 7 Choose Menu > Network Config and press Select. Scroll to CDP TX Enable/Disable and press Select. Scroll to Enable or Disable and press Select. A check mark appears next to the selected item. The default is Enable. Press Back to return to the menu. Scroll to CDP TTL (time to live) and press Select. Press Edit to enter the appropriate value (default is 180). Then press Back. Scroll to CDP TX Interval and press Select. Press Edit to enter the appropriate value (default is 60). Then press Back.
